2. I’m born from a spark, I grow when you feed me.
Flame
3. I dance but have no legs. I roar but have no throat.
Campfire
4. I glow red when you touch me. Stay too long and I’ll burn you.
Ember
5. I shout loud when smoke is near.
Smoke alarm
6. Break my glass to make me sing.
Fire alarm button
7. I have a hose but no garden. I fight flames all day.
Fire truck
8. I spray foam when danger comes close.
Fire extinguisher
9. I sleep in winter, I roar in summer, I can burn the forest.
Wildfire
10. I stay in your kitchen, I cook your meals.
Stove flame
11. I’m carried on a stick, I guide travelers in the dark.
Torch
12. I’m small, I flicker, I melt as I shine.
Candle
13. I sit in a ring, I roast marshmallows with you.
Fire pit
14. I’m made of metal, you turn me for fire.
Lighter
15. Strike me once, and I wake with light.
Matchstick
16. I rain water on fire from the ceiling.
Fire sprinkler
17. I have a ladder and a bell. I rush when sirens yell.
Fire engine
18. I’m invisible but I feed fire.
Oxygen
19. I turn paper black and leave dust behind.
Flame
20. I eat everything but never get full.
Fire
21. I roar in the fireplace on a cold night.
Hearth fire
22. I start small, I grow big, fan me and I spread quick.
Spark
23. I glow white, I light paths, but I am still fire.
Lantern flame
24. I’m dangerous alone but safe when watched.
Campfire
25. I hiss when you light me, I burn blue.
Gas flame
26. I burn houses when left alone.
House fire
27. I’m red and gold, I light the sky on festivals.
Bonfire
28. I heat metal until it bends.
Furnace flame
29. I’m small, but I can start a forest fire.
Match
30. I wear yellow and save lives.
Firefighter
31. I burn fast, I vanish in seconds.
Sparkler
32. I live in a glass and run on oil.
Oil lamp
33. I warm your hands, but hurt if you touch me.
Campfire flame
34. I’m scary, I can explode, but I keep cars alive.
Gasoline fire
35. I glow red, orange, yellow, never green.
Fire
36. I’m a puzzle that burns bright. Solve me fast before night ends.
Riddle of fire
